Meet our latest creation, Bestest Boy, our take on a truly classic English Best Bitter.

We’ve built this one on a beautiful, rich malt foundation of Crisp Maris Otter and Dark Crystal, giving it that gorgeous, deep copper colour and a satisfyingly complex caramel backbone. But where this bitter really shines is in the hop profile.

We’ve carefully layered this brew from the boil right through to the dry hop. A touch of Challenger sets the bittering stage for the real stars of the show: Bramling Cross and Ernest. We’ve used generous additions of both in the boil, the steep, and the dry hop to extract every ounce of flavour. Expect a beautiful balance of dark berry and subtle spicy notes from the Bramling Cross, perfectly complemented by the modern apricot and citrus characteristics of the UK Ernest hops.

Fermented with a traditional Old English yeast for that authentic, slightly fruity ester profile, it’s a beautifully conditioned, highly drinkable beer that champions the very best of classic British brewing. Cheers!
